SanDisk Optimus GX PRO 8100 Spec and Price in the United States
$999.00 MSRP
Priced at $999 for 2TB, the Optimus GX PRO 8100 is SanDisk's PCIe 5.0 flagship, pushing 14,900/14,000 MB/s sequential and random IOPS above 2.3 million on the back of a DRAM-backed design. A 1,200TB endurance rating and 5-year warranty back up throughput that roughly doubles every gen4 drive in this lineup. It's built for workstation and high-end content-creation loads where PCIe 5.0 bandwidth actually gets used, not casual desktop tasks.

What owners and reviewers say
Summarised from 1 source(s), reviewed September 14, 2026. A source is counted only where it names this model exactly. How we track prices
Commonly praised
- Reviewers called the 8TB version the finest high-capacity PCIe 5.0 drive they had tested, with high all-around performance and exceptional random read latency.
- It was praised for good power efficiency, drawing well under the earliest high-end Gen5 drives while sustaining top-tier throughput.
- It ships with SanDisk's Dashboard and Acronis software and is backed by a five-year warranty.
Commonly criticised
- Its price was the main criticism, with the drive costing noticeably more than the equivalent WD Black SN8100 at review time.
